The long-term impact of groundwater heat pump use in areas where annual heating loads exceed cooling loads may be to lower groundwater temperatures. Link to ARCGis Online app for Soil Temperature. The temperature data are available in the downloads (csv, txt, json). The thermally impacted area in both cases though was of large enough extent after 10 years to tentatively conclude that it is not feasible to use heat pump systems of this type in densely populated areas. The impact of the use of a groundwater heat pump for residential heating and cooling on groundwater temperatures was simulated by means of a mathematical model that couples the equations for groundwater flow with those for heat transport. 60487 - Frankfurt Am Main.
